Neu -- There are pictures of a few 3 CLY Sherman IIs in 4 Armd Bde in The Sherman Tank in British Service, one of "CROCK" from C Squadron on p.32, and another on p.39, bereft of markings but with M34A1 combination gun mount and extended end connectors on metal chevron tracks.

British Tanks in Normandy has a whole chapter on 4th Armd Bde; notable to me is a 44th RTR Sherman II with the number 3 inside its blue tactical triangle on the turret side, cupola 0.5-inch MG, 124 tactical insignia on rear right, remnants of the waterproof exhaust trunking, and the front mudguards welded to the rear as stowage racks. The image is from the IWM: http://www.iwm.org.uk/collections/item/object/205087523

There's also a colour profile of a Sherman II, "REBEL" of B Sqn, 44 RTR, from 4th Armd Bde.

Hi I would like to join the GB, im proposing a model of the U-480 type VIIc u boat with scnorkel and Albrecht anti sonar coating, its patrol started on 3rd august 1944 and finished 4th October 1944, it was in the area and sunk the Normandy anti submarine sweeper HMCS alberni on 21st august 1944 followed by three other vessels in the next couple of days completely undetected.

No. The fluid is ejected some distance and only when it is vapour/oxygen then it can be ignited. Much like a gas cigarette lighter; its never scorched where the gas exits.

Also; the same type of fluid was used in man-held flame throwers. The men wore heat proof gloves, protection against the heat of the delivery tube, but the men were never scorched by their own weapon.
